Pearl Creek Colony is a Hutterite colony and census-designated place (CDP) in Beadle County, South Dakota, United States. It was first listed as a CDP prior to the 2020 census. The population of the CDP was 99 at the 2020 census. It is on the northwest side of Middle Pearl Creek, a southwest-flowing tributary of the James River. It is 5 miles (8 km) southwest of Iroquois and 18 miles (29 km) east-southeast of Huron.
